About Cottle Periosteal Raspatory
SCHILLING MEDIYSTEMA Cottle Periosteal Raspatory, also known as a Cottle Periosteal Elevator, isa specialized surgical instrument used in procedures like rhinoplasty (nose surgery) and other ENT (ear, nose, and throat) surgeries.It is designed to elevate, dissect, and separate the periosteum (the membrane covering bones) from the underlying bone, particularly in the nasal and facial regions.
